摘要
Sodium chloride exists as a contact ion pair (CIP) as well as a solvent-separated ion pair (SSIP) in its solutions in water and in dimethyl sulphoxide (DMSO). In a mixture of these two solvents, the CIP is not formed in the two mixture compositions with χdmso=0.35 and 0.21 and the ions stay as the SSIP near an interionic distance of 5.0 Å. This has been shown by constructing the ion-ion potentials of mean force and by following the ion-pair trajectories initiated at various initial ion-pair separations in the two solvent mixtures.
